Overview
Sunitinib, sold under the brand name Sutent, is a multi-targeted receptor tyrosine kinase inhibitor that has revolutionized the treatment of renal cell carcinoma (RCC) and imatinib-resistant gastrointestinal stromal tumor (GIST). With its approval by the FDA in January 2006, sunitinib became the first cancer drug to be simultaneously approved for two different indications. As of August 2021, sunitinib is available as a generic medicine in the US, making it more accessible to patients. The medication has been shown to improve progression-free survival and overall survival in patients with RCC and GIST, with response rates ranging from 31% to 47%. ⚙️ Mechanism of Action
The mechanism of action of sunitinib involves the inhibition of multiple receptor tyrosine kinases, including vascular endothelial growth factor receptors (VEGFR), platelet-derived growth factor receptors (PDGFR), and c-Kit. This multi-targeted approach allows sunitinib to effectively block tumor growth and angiogenesis, making it a valuable treatment option for patients with RCC and GIST.
